Start with your practice goals, January is the perfect time to ask yourself:

  • Where do I want my practice to be this time next year?
  • Do I have a clear picture of my revenue streams and any gaps?
  • Is my current fee structure aligned with my financial objectives?

Whether you’re planning to grow your patient base, switch plan provider, or reduce NHS dependency, clarity on your financial landscape is key.
